Dec 31, 2008 as a note, doing more digging i found a reference to use padding. Css level 1 the definition of paddingtop in that specification. I have two divs, and i float the first one to right, also i set second divs margin top to 30px. The margin top css property sets the margin area on the top of an element. This is a new one on me and any help would be greatly appreciated. If you look at the pictures below you can see how the blue inner div moves down independently in ie but in firefox the black outer div gets pushed down with the inner blue div as well. Negative values for margin properties are allowed, but there may be implementationspecific limits. I want to put a 10px margin on a div but it is not appearing in firefox. I have searched the internet and seen people complaining of a negative margin in firefox but no fixes. It is a shorthand for margintop, marginright, marginbottom, and marginleft. Sorry for the duplicate, but i think the first one went to all products and im afraid it might get lost. I have two divs, and i float the first one to right, also i set second divs margintop to 30px.
Apr 27, 2017 the trick is to set the height of the parent element to zero and its padding top property to be equal to the value of the desired aspect ratio expressed as a percentage. When i set margintop on the inputs, the margin of the floating div is affected as well. I had hoped this would bring the second div down a little bit and give some space to the first floated div. But there is actually a really straightforward way of handling this in css now. I have css in a stationery file tried it in a signature also and thunderbird recognizes the css while im editingcomposing it, but if i send it to myself, it does not honor it. The problem is that firefox shows a marginpadding at the top of an element e. Css margins displaying differently on firefoxiechrome. There is a small margin between the close button and the.
May 23, 2008 firefox adheres to this and uses the 1px. I prefer using negative margintop for the footer and paddingbottom on the element that is to leave space for the footer. Issue with negative margin value in firefox stack overflow. The numbers in the table specify the first browser version that fully supports the property.
Css issues with topbottom margins on divs in firefox css. This is one of the more interesting problems that i have encountered in developing my website. Indeed in our sticky footer quiz a while ago a fix for an opera bug was found using. Normally, the browser would take the first paragraphs marginbottom and the second ones margintop, figure out which one is larger, and apply that margin between the two, which would yield max15px,1em 1em. When negative margins are involved, the size of the collapsed. Find answers to firefox mac negative margin top issue from the expert community at experts exchange. Jan 22, 2007 for me it happened in firefox and opera, turned out to be margin top.
The css margin properties are used to create space around elements, outside of any defined borders. Negative values draw the element closer to its neighbors than it. For some reason it will not position itself directly under the header div. I want to combine two customizations in firefox 60. Midimagic, if different browsers then apply different settings, the only way to get around will be, as i was suggested, to use a different stylesheet for ie then. Now we treated negative margintop and bottom fully. The margin property defines the outermost portion of the box model, creating space around an element, outside of any defined borders margins are set using lengths, percentages, or the keyword auto and can have negative values. Find answers to firefox mac negative margintop issue from the expert community at experts exchange.
Dig into the knowledge base, tips and tricks, troubleshooting, and so much more. It is a shorthand for margin top, margin right, margin bottom, and margin left. How do i get my single spaced sidebar bookmarks back to single spacing with writing code. The margintop property sets the top margin of an element. Really simple stuff but its only a problem in firefox. Like the problem i am having with the horizontal line that is not centred in ie but it is in firefox et al. Jul 27, 2009 because of this, css layouts have since then been synonymous with coding elegance. Jun 15, 2016 my site is a fullscroll, and the problematic area is section 7. A simple css spacing library for margins, paddings and more later. The padding top property is specified as a single value chosen from the list below. Apparently there is some weird standards issue in firefox where the extra space shows up. Good css support is one of geckos strong points, everytime you convince a. The margintop css property sets the top margin of the element. I have set the top margin to 0 but in firefox this is not viewing properly.
How can i move the open menu hamburger button to the. You may have expected that the paragraph would be located 60px from the heading, since the div element has a margintop of 40px and there is a further 20px margintop on the p element. Nov 20, 2012 i have searched the internet and seen people complaining of a negative margin in firefox but no fixes. The top property affects the vertical position of a positioned element. However, in this particular article, we are going to discuss about the negative margin or negative margin spacing and common problems with it. A positive value places it farther from its neighbors, while a negative. Was having trouble with the amazing but rather tightly coded newspaper theme. There are properties for setting the margin for each side of an element top, right, bottom, and left. If this still doesnt work then set a negative margintop to move the items up. The value in the css margintop property can be expressed as either a fixed value or as a percentage.
Css level 2 revision 1 the definition of margintop in that specification. Unfortunately, customize does not allow one to move the open menu button in. How do i get my single spaced sidebar bookmarks back to. Hey, im just learning css at the moment and am having an irritating problem with firefox. The source for this interactive example is stored in a github repository. Limitedtime offer applies to the first charge of a new subscription only. Aug 30, 2014 i had to use margin top 6px on rakebackbox like i said so it didnt overlap the rakeback h2 heading. Am i right in thinking that mozilla doesnt recognise margin top margin left etc. Css basic box model the definition of margintop in that specification. Browsers like ie, firefox and chrome will also be considered here. This is the css for each row that has a green check at the end.
I have validated the page and css, no problems there site is working properly in firefox and ie, seems to be a margin issue in safarithis margin issue is not the common safari bug with a negative margin being applied to a floated elementi am using safari in a windows environment, i do not have a. Move the open menu hamburger button to the left hand side in firefox 60. Feb 21, 2020 but there is actually a really straightforward way of handling this in css now. A positive value places it farther from its neighbors, while a negative value places it closer. Its like an online tabooeveryones doing it, yet no one wants to talk. However in many cases the shorthand property margin is more convenient to use and preferable the following table summarizes the usages context and the version history of this property.
My negative margin works in chrome but doesnt in firefox. If you use negative top margin, then you have to carry the negative value to each item in the second column. Using individual margin properties this div element has a top margin of 100px, a right margin of 150px, a bottom margin of 100px, and a left margin of 80px. If youd like to contribute to the interactive examples project, please clone. Unlike margins, negative values are not allowed for padding. The margintop property is specified as the keyword auto, or a, or a. The top and bottom margins of blocks are sometimes combined collapsed. The margin css property sets the margin area on all four sides of an element. Why is this, and how the f can i stop it from happening relevant html. Firebug is a firefox extension that puts a wealth of web development tools at your fingertips while you browse. In fact negative margins are valid css and extremely useful in certain situations. The definitive guide to using negative margins smashing magazine. This article compares cascading style sheets css support for several browser engines.
The margin bottom property is specified as the keyword auto, or a, or a. Jan 27, 2015 however, the normal possible values of margin in css are measured in auto, length, percentage and inherit. The marginright css property sets the margin area on the right side of an element. When the value is provided as a percentage, it is relative to the width of the containing block. Security advisories for firefox impact key critical vulnerability can be used to run attacker code and install software, requiring no user interaction beyond normal browsing. The definitive guide to using negative margins smashing. Css basic box model the definition of paddingtop in that specification.
Firefox margintop mystery css forum at webmasterworld. Any css tweak seemed to break the layout when viewed in firefox. Attempt to recreate cj gammons portfolio grid hover effect using svg clippath and css transitions. The problem is that the content after doesnt follow it. Out of all the css concepts designers have ever used, an award probably needs to be given to the use of negative margins as being the most least talked about method of positioning. Css margin settings reflect in firefox browser not in chrome. Css margin issue in safari not the negative margin on. When a static element is given a negative margin on the topleft, it pulls the.
We all use margins in our css, but when it comes to negative. If setting the relativity doesnt fix the problem, let us know and well figure. Viewing 3 posts 1 through 3 of 3 total author posts may 29, 2014 at 12. Chrome respects the margin, and forces the following content to sit beneath it, whereas ff does not. Google chrome and all other chromium based browsers such as opera and. Because of this, css layouts have since then been synonymous with coding elegance. My site is a fullscroll, and the problematic area is section 7. Css level 2 revision 1 the definition of paddingtop in that specification. Firefox mac negative margintop issue solutions experts.
Mar 04, 20 the difference in layout between ff and chrome looks to be due to the margin on your h2. Negative values are allowed in the css margintop property. Css transitions the definition of margintop in that specification. Viewing 15 posts 1 through 15 of 15 total author posts january 25, 20 at 9. The size of the margin as a percentage, relative to the width of the containing block. This plugin uses a known workaround to achieve the same thing in flexbox, which is to apply negative margin on the container element and positive. The positive side of negative margins a number of people suffer under the misconception that negative margins are in some way a hack. The trick is to set the height of the parent element to zero and its padding top property to be equal to the value of the desired aspect ratio expressed as a percentage.
Essentially, the problem is that i have a containing div, contentmain, that is parent to one div, contentbar, which has two horizontally stacked child div elements, infoboxl and infoboxr. Im still confused why that worked, but no more mystery margin above that div and no border top needed. Aug 30, 2014 indeed in our sticky footer quiz a while ago a fix for an opera bug was found using. It works ok in ie, but in firefox, it seems like the first div is dragged down. I replaced margintop with top with the same value, and i. I had to use margintop 6px on rakebackbox like i said so it didnt overlap the rakeback h2 heading. Css3 how to target only ie, firefox, chrome, safari. Even trying to override the top margin with some css like margintop. I have a div floating to the left of two text input elements. Safari browser, plus all browsers hosted on the ios app store. For example, lets consider a box with a width of 200px and a height of 200px, padding of 10px on all sides and a border of 2px all round. The zindex css property sets the zorder of a positioned element and its. Comparison of browser engines css support wikipedia. Negative values draw the element closer to its neighbors than it would be by default.
687 665 1130 1486 1513 341 1203 560 194 1100 549 1193 584 763 1225 935 1423 1127 683 904 1452 128 858 889 820 912 181 1285 1372 389 411 961 1193 1442 61 588 559 592 244 405 312 210 323 1351 1234 1111